This special version of the Southern Natchez Trace
bicycle tour incorporates the very best accommodations and dining that southern Mississippi
has to offer and is designed to showcase the
Great Mississippi Balloon Race. We start in the capital of
Jackson, Mississippi and traverse the historic Natchez Trace
to the beautiful city of Natchez, MS. Our journey will see us staying
in magnificent Antebellum mansions, dining on
classic southern cuisine, cycling some the
South's most beautiful stretches of road and
participating in one of the most scenic events
in the South.
Detailed Itinerary
Day 1 - The Capital City of Mississippi
After settling into your room
at the historic Old Capital Inn we get
together in the early evening for an informal greeting where we will go over the
trip itinerary before heading to dinner at one of the many fine restaurants in Jackson, MS..
Meals: Dinner
Day 2 - Cycle around the
Beautiful Ross Barnett Reservoir
After a delicious full southern breakfast served at our inn we take a short shuttle to the Natchez Trace where we
will embark on a very scenic ride around the
Ross Barnett Reservoir. After arriving back at
the Old Capital Inn we will have the
opportunity of taking in some of the many
historic sights in downtown Jackson.
Meals: Breakfast, Lunch, Dinner
Mileage: options ranging from 25+ to 40+ miles
Day 3 - Natchez Trace
Today we depart Jackson in route to Natchez,
MS. We will break the route to Natchez in to
two days of cycling. Day one will see us
cycling to Port Gibson where we will
possibly take in some of the historic sights
in this community. After a brief shuttle to
the beautiful Historic Natchez Inn we will
enjoy a moment of relaxation before setting
out to the premier event of the Balloon
Race, the Glow. After this beautiful
and exciting event we will venture into town
for a wonderful meal.
Meals: Breakfast, Lunch, Dinner
Mileage: options ranging from 25+ to 50+ miles
Day 4 - The Completion
of the Natchez Trace
Today we will complete our
cycling journey along the Natchez Trace. There
are several options for additional touring
along the way, including a loop that goes by
some off the path plantations. Today's
activities will also include watching the
Balloon Race competitors pit their
navigational skills against each other.
Tonight we will share a celebratory meal at
one of Natchez's many fine downtown
restaurants.
Meals: Breakfast, Lunch, Dinner
Mileage: options ranging from 25+ to 50+ miles
Day 5 - Shuttle Back to
Jackson, MS
After a relaxing breakfast we
will say goodbye to our hosts and shuttle back
to the origination point. Depending on the
departure schedule of our guests and the event
schedule of the Balloon Race we may catch
one last glimpse of this beautiful event. The shuttle will
take approximately two hours which will give you plenty of time to reflect on the experiences of the past few days with your new found friends.
Meals: Breakfast, Lunch
